Abstract

In accordance with an aspect of the present invention, an information processing apparatus includes an interface that transmits or receives data to or from an input apparatus that inputs user position information indicating a position of a user, and a processor that calculates an evaluation value for an evaluation target position based on the user position information, determines a position in a virtual space or a real space where an agent supporting the user is placed based on the evaluation value, and places the agent at the determined position in the virtual space or real space.
